IEEE Transactions on Power Electronics, 1997
A new method for predicting the stray capacitance of inductors is presented. The method is based on an analytical approach and the physical structure of inductors. The inductor winding is partitioned into basic cells-many of which are identical. An expression for the equivalent capacitance of the basic cell is derived.

EMC Europe 2009 Workshop, 2009
Traditional materials for coils and common mode chokes are iron and ferrites. Iron has a high saturation level but low permeability, and ferrite has low saturation and high permeability. Nanocrystalline materials are a rather new material with a high saturation and a high permeability.

The inductor as a transmission line
Proceedings of the IEEE, 1987Research into the interconnection of high-speed logic causes us to re-evaluate and modify the traditional view of circuit components like inductors, and to realize that they are not lumped but are distributed in space.

Application of the inductor multiplier
2006 13th IEEE International Conference on Electronics, Circuits and Systems, 2006A current mode active inductor multiplier[1] is obtained using the Miller capacitor by the dual circuit generation technique. To apply the active inductor multiplier to the filters and oscillators, a bi-directional CCCS and multiplication factor control circuit for the variable active inductor multiplier circuit are reported.
